About The Position

Performs a variety of skilled and semi-skilled maintenance and construction activities in the multi-functional operations of the Manatee County highway and storm water systems. Works with assigned crew on a variety of infrastructure construction projects, such as roads, storm drains, and bridges. Follows all established safety standards and procedures.

Responsibilities

  • Applies knowledge of and skill in maintenance and/or construction principles and practices to safely and efficiently performing assigned duties.
  • Works with assigned crew on a variety of infrastructure construction projects, such as roads, storm drains, bridges, marine construction, water distribution, back flow prevention, and sewer transmission.
  • Follows all established safety standards and procedures.
  • Performs routine skilled and semi-skilled maintenance and construction activities, such as cleaning ditches and culverts, preparing surfaces, operating mechanized equipment, basic vehicle maintenance, and flagging operations.
  • Performs moderately difficult skilled and semi-skilled maintenance and construction activities, such as cleaning ditches and culverts, building catch basins, installing drainage lines, operating power tools and mechanized equipment, basic vehicle maintenance, and flagging operations.
  • Performs difficult and moderately complex skilled and semi-skilled maintenance and construction activities, such as cleaning ditches and culverts, building catch basins, installing drainage lines, operating power tools and mechanized equipment, basic vehicle maintenance, and flagging operations. Trains and assists less experienced technicians.
  • Performs a variety of difficult and complex skilled and semi-skilled maintenance and construction activities. Inspects pavement surfaces and storm water structures. Acts in a lead capacity, assigning and monitoring daily work activities and training less experienced technicians.
